Minal Shah

Associate Director, Quality Management at Duke Clinical Research Institute

Minal Shah is an experienced professional in quality management, currently serving as Associate Director of Quality Management at Duke Clinical Research Institute since May 2016, after holding the position of Senior Quality Assurance Manager. Prior to this role, Minal was the Site Quality Assurance Manager at Sequenom Laboratories from February 2013 to December 2015, where responsibilities included directing the evaluation and implementation of the Quality Management System Manual and managing credential activities for regulatory agencies. Minal's early career includes positions as a Clinical Laboratory Scientist/Medical Technologist at Duke University Health System and Hackensack University Medical Center from January 2001 to January 2013. Minal is also pursuing further education as a Duke Management Academy Scholar at Duke University and holds a PMP - Project Management Professional Certification from the Project Management Institute, completed in December 2019.

Duke Clinical Research Institute

As part of the Duke University School of Medicine, the Duke Clinical Research Institute (DCRI) is known globally for conducting groundbreaking multinational trials, managing major national patient registries, and performing landmark research. As an academic clinical research organization, we combine the faculty expertise of practicing physicians with the full-service operational capabilities of a major CRO. We design and implement innovative clinical trials that advance the understanding of health and disease and inform efforts to improve the quality of care. Our experience stretches from phase I to phase IV and beyond, encompassing post-approval analyses and health economics. The breadth of our work in numerous therapeutic areas is matched by the depth of our knowledge, which we disseminate through high-impact publications and global meetings. Since 1996, DCRI's faculty and staff have disseminated over 17,500 peer-reviewed publications and have been cited in over 760,500 scientific articles.
